Dating Confidence Reset
Start by clarifying what you really want. Decide whether you’re browsing for casual conversation, a new friend, or something long-term, and write down one or two nonnegotiables plus one flexible preference. Having clear intent helps you make faster choices and prevents you from feeling pulled in every direction.
Set realistic expectations
Remember that most conversations won’t become something deeper, and that’s normal. Expect a mix of quick chats, polite dead-ends, and the occasional promising connection. Treat each interaction as information—not as a final verdict on your worth.
Pace conversations with purpose
Let conversation tempo match the person and the signal they give. If someone responds thoughtfully, invest more time. If responses are curt or inconsistent, slow down and keep your options open. Aim for steady, two-way exchanges rather than rushing to exchange contact details or plan a date immediately.
Measure progress by small wins
Track tangible, low-pressure indicators of progress: a reply that shows curiosity, a shared story, or an exchanged phone call. Celebrate these small wins instead of waiting only for a “perfect” match. Noticing progress keeps momentum and reduces discouragement.
Choose matches more thoughtfully
Use your nonnegotiables to filter profiles quickly. Look for signs of effort in messages and profile detail—people who write more than a one-line bio or ask a question are usually more engaged. Don’t feel obligated to reply to every match; prioritize energy on conversations that feel reciprocal.
Protect your emotional energy
Limit how much time you spend swiping or replying in one sitting. Schedule short, focused sessions and then step away. When you feel discouraged, take a non-dating break—exercise, call a friend, or do a hobby—and come back refreshed.
Keep self-respect front and center
Set boundaries about what you will tolerate and how you communicate. If someone is rude, ghosting, or pushing you toward something you haven’t agreed to, pause the conversation. Saying no or stepping away is a confident choice, not a failure.
Practice gentle curiosity
Ask open but simple questions that reveal values and routines rather than aiming for instant chemistry. Curiosity lowers pressure, opens real connection, and helps you decide faster whether to continue investing time.
Resetting confidence is about small, repeatable habits: clearer goals, kinder expectations, steady pacing, and protecting your time and dignity. Use these practices on Mingle2 to stay grounded, avoid the numbers-game mindset, and date with more patience and self-respect.
